Knitting Patterns for Carnival Costumes

  1. Creating vibrant, carnival-themed knitting designs for costumes

    Carnival costumes are all about bright colors and fun designs. When knitting for a carnival, think of bold patterns and lively hues. Use yarns in reds, blues, yellows, and greens to make your costumes stand out. Adding glittery or shiny threads can also make your designs pop.

    Here are some tips for creating vibrant carnival costumes:

    • Choose bright colors: Pick yarns in neon or primary colors.
    • Incorporate patterns: Use stripes, polka dots, or zigzags.
    • Add embellishments: Use beads, sequins, or feathers.

Knitting Patterns for Carnival Decorations

  • Transforming your space with knitting decorations for carnivals:

    Knitting can turn any space into a carnival wonderland. Imagine colorful banners, vibrant tablecloths, and unique wall hangings. These knitted decorations add a personal touch and make your carnival feel special.

    For example, you can knit bright bunting to hang around the venue. Use bold colors like red, yellow, and blue. These colors are eye-catching and fun.

    Another idea is to create knitted table runners. These can be in various patterns, like stripes or polka dots. They will make your tables look festive and inviting.

    Don’t forget about knitted wall art. You can make large, decorative pieces to hang on the walls. These can be in the shape of carnival masks or other fun designs.

Knitting Ideas for Festivals Beyond Carnivals

Knitting Patterns for Different Festivals

  1. Adapting carnival knitting patterns for other festivals

    Carnival knitting patterns are full of color and fun. You can use these patterns for other festivals too. For example, a bright carnival scarf can be perfect for a summer fair. Just change the colors to match the festival theme. If it’s a winter festival, use warm colors like red and green. This way, you can use one pattern for many events.

  2. Exploring knitting designs for various cultural festivals

    Different cultures have unique festivals. Each festival has its own colors and symbols. For example, Diwali is a festival of lights in India. You can knit items with bright colors like yellow and orange. For Chinese New Year, use red and gold. These colors bring good luck. By exploring different designs, you can create special items for each festival.

Festival Colors Common Knitting Items
Diwali Yellow, Orange Scarves, Shawls
Chinese New Year Red, Gold Hats, Mittens
Christmas Red, Green Sweaters, Stockings
